一、概述
阿里前端框架是阿里巴巴集團開發的一套前端應用解決方案,旨在提高前端開發效率和質量。它是一個完整的生態系統,包括 Web 應用程序和移動應用程序兩個部分。
阿里前端框架的主要特點是易於使用、高效性、可用性和可擴展性。它提供了常用組件、模板、模塊及工具鏈,為開發者提供了高效的開發體驗。
目前,阿里前端框架支持多個版本,其中包括Vue版、React版、Angular版等,滿足不同項目的需求。
二、核心組件
1.antd
antd是一套UI組件庫,基於React開發,提供了豐富的組件和模板,旨在為開發者提供高效的開發體驗和一致的UI風格。它提供了 Button、Table、Form、Input等常用組件,簡化了前端開發的難度。
代碼示例:
{`import { Button } from 'antd';
const Demo = () => (
);
`}
2.fusion
fusion是一套基於Web Components的UI組件庫,可用於 Web 應用程序和移動應用程序的開發。它提供了一套完整的組件體系,包括布局、導航、表單等組件。fusion通過Web Components規範,提供了與其他框架和庫的互操作性。
代碼示例:
{`
Header
Content
Footer
`}
3.ice
ice是一種基於React開發的應用程序,可實現應用程序的快速開發和構建。ice提供了一套完整的解決方案,包括開發工具、腳手架、命令行工具等,極大地降低了開發者的學習和使用成本。ice支持webpack、babel、eslint等技術棧,使開發者能夠快速地構建高效、可維護、可測試的應用程序。
代碼示例:
{`import React, { Component } from 'react';
import { Link } from 'react-router';class Home extends Component {
render() {
return (
HOME
- ABOUT
- SERVICES
- CONTACT
原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-hant/n/227219.html